The ideal insulation piece for coldweather activities, especially in wetter climates, The North Face Redpoint Optimus Jacket for Men is highly durable and built with PrimaLoft One synthetic insulation, which will retain warmth even when wet. With an attached adjustable hood, a water resistant coating, and seamless yoke and shoulders you can really hunker down and stay warm when necessary, but will be comfortable carrying a pack when the schedules demands proceeding.

The perfect backpacking jacket?
I bought two of these jackets from Altrec...one for backpacking/kayaking and one for urban/mall wear. I used it for a Wind River/Wyoming early summer trec.and an early season, week long Voyageurs NP kayak trip in wet/windy weather. Stuffs very compact into it's own pocket...extremely light weight...is water proof (tested in downpours)...fits big enough to layer under if the layer is not too bulky since it is overall somewhat of an athletic fit. I usually wear a large and ended up with 2 mediums since the cuffs allowed the sleeves to slip onto my hands too far. I love the tighter fit the mediums allow but maybe most would like the "average/normal" fit which you get by ordering your actual true size. I tried many many jackets and with the weight/fit/compact stuff size not to mention being extremely attractive (tons of compliments) I had to order another one...it was that great!!
